The William Way Center has selected two paintings by Bucks County artist Gene Underwood for its 20th Annual Juried Exhibition. Artists from the Philadelphia metro area submitted work, and 47 artists were chosen to exhibit one or two works. Juror Stamatina Gregory chose “Neither Straight nor True” and “Bubble Double” from the five works that Underwood submitted. They are examples of his ongoing series that surprisingly includes bubble wrap as a subject. “I am hellbent on innovating the still life tradition so it reflects our LED-lighted 21st century. When I carefully render commonplace items—bubble wrap, Post-its, paper coffee cups, or Ziplock bags—in traditional oil paint, there’s irony. Look deeper and you may find beauty there and a bit of ecological anxiety,” Underwood says. Recently, Underwood’s innovative paintings were chosen for Ellarslie Open 46 in Trenton and the 96th Phillips’ Mill Juried Art Show.

Bucks County Community College is pleased to announce The Creative Genes, an exhibition of historic and contemporary artworks and writing from personal collections, the Moravian Archives, the Petrucci Family Foundation Collection of African American Art.(PFFCAAA) and The Volta Center for Writing Arts. The exhibition will be on view from December 3, 2025 to February 28, 2026, with an opening reception held on December 3 from 4 – 8 pm at Hicks Art Center Gallery. Volta Workshop Writers read at 5:30pm.
